As the Crème School Executive Director, you will serve as the transformative leader responsible for the overall management, strategic direction, and success of our early childhood education organization. This executive position involves engaging in Crème de la Crème's mission, fostering a positive culture, and ensuring the delivery of high-quality educational programs. Your leadership will contribute to the development of young children and the advancement of Crème's mission and goals!
As the Crème School Executive Director you will:
- Develop and articulate a compelling vision and strategic plan for your school, aligning with the mission and goals.
- Provide transformative leadership to inspire and guide the organization toward continuous improvement and excellence.
- Provide leadership and direction to all staff (including two salaried employees), fostering a culture of collaboration, professional growth, and accountability.
- Recruit, hire, and retain a diverse and skilled workforce.
- Be responsible for the implementation, and continuous improvement of high-quality early childhood education programs.
- Ensure curriculum alignment with state standards and the needs of the community.
- Develop and manage your school's budget, ensuring financial sustainability and responsible resource allocation.
- Cultivate positive relationships with parents, families, and the community; including retention of families, enrolling/touring potential families, and the overall school engagement
- Represent your school at community events, collaborate with local organizations, and advocate for early childhood education.
- Assist as needed in daily school operations, at times including direct supervision of children
- Maintain all relevant regulations, laws, and policies related to early childhood education. Ensure your school's compliance with accreditation standards and licensing requirements.
- Establish and maintain high-quality standards for educational programs and overall operations. Implement continuous improvement strategies based on data-driven insights.
Qualifications:
- Bachelor's degree in early childhood education, Education Administration, or related field.
- Meet state specific credentials / guidelines for the role
- At least 3 years executive leadership experience in early childhood education or a related field
- Solid understanding of early childhood development, educational best practices, and program administration.
- Outstanding communication and interpersonal skills
- Excellent customer service skills, strong organizational skills, and multi-task and handle multiple situations simultaneously.
- Proven track record to build and sustain positive relationships with diverse staff ,families, and community
- Dedication to diversity, equity, and inclusion in education.
- Able to use a computer with basic proficiency, lift a minimum of 40 pounds, and work indoors or outdoors.
- Able to assume postures in low levels to allow physical and visual contact with children, see and hear well enough to keep children safe, and engage in physical activity.
- Read, write, understand, and speak English to connect with children and their parents in English
